## Configuration

BouncePress processes DSN messages and fires plugin hooks on hard bounces. Set BP_MODE to `strict` or `lenient`. Plugins load from the `handlers/` directory; declare capabilities in the manifest. Retries: three, exponential. Logs go to stdout only. The processor refuses to boot without the webhook signing secret, which must appear in the env file directly after this comment:

sealed setting: ARCHIVE_KEY3=8d0

Currency conversion in Tillgrove's payout service uses banker's rounding, and most rounding-error pages trace back to a stale FX cache rather than the math itself. If totals drift by more than a cent, force a rate refresh via the admin endpoint. That refresh call authenticates against the Norrbeck rates provider, and the service reads the provider credential from its env file at startup. Add the rates provider credential to the env file first.

secret setting of hawep-yahig: LEDGER_TOKEN29=41b5d6315371c92885eaeb077fb63

// TURNSTILE_COUNT_WINDOW_MS
// Aggregation window for the Harborfield Stadium turnstile counter.
// On-call: do not shorten this below 500ms — the gate sensors at the
// north concourse batch their pulses, and a tighter window double-counts
// entries during peak ingress. Any change must reference the build token
// recorded directly below this comment.

pipeline stamp: htk9_ce63042d9

Heads up, support folks: the Brightlark JavaScript SDK and the Brightlark Swift SDK are supposed to ship feature-for-feature, but they don't always. Any gap (missing method, mismatched defaults, different retry behavior) needs an approved parity ticket before we promise customers a fix date. Don't guess timelines — parity work often touches both codebases and the shared spec in Lanternfile. If a customer asks why Swift lags, point them to the public roadmap, nothing else. All parity exceptions must be approved by the person below.

account owner for bawip-tahag: Raleth Quenok